      Content of Learning Activity

      Photography Course for Architecture StudentsLesson 1: Introduction to Architectural Photography

      Understanding the basic principles of architectural photography.
      Presentation of the necessary photographic equipment.
      Hands-on exercises in equipment handling.

      Lesson 2: Architectural Composition and Framing

      Exploration of composition concepts in architectural photography.
      Framing techniques to emphasize architectural elements.
      Practice: Capturing buildings from various angles.

      Lesson 3: Using Light in Architectural Photography

      Importance of natural and artificial lighting.
      Lighting techniques to highlight architectural details.
      Practical outing: Photography using different light sources.

      Lesson 4: Interior and Exterior Photography

      Approaches to interior architectural photography.
      Overcoming challenges of exterior photography.
      Practice: Photographing both the interior and exterior of a building.

      Lesson 5: Image Processing and Post-Production

      Introduction to photo editing software, including Adobe Lightroom.
      Image retouching to enhance visual quality.
      Post-production exercises on previously taken photos.

      Lesson 6: Architectural Project Photography

      Techniques for photographing complete architectural projects.
      Practical application: Photographing a detailed architectural project.
      Case study: Reviewing photographs of famous architectural projects.

      Lesson 7: Final Presentation and Evaluation

      Preparing a presentation of photographic projects.
      Presenting to a peer and teacher group.
      Final evaluation of architectural photography skills.

      This simplified outline provides a structure for practical lessons in an architecture student photography course. Each lesson covers specific aspects of architectural photography, progressing from composition and lighting to post-production and the final presentation of projects. Practical outings allow students to apply their knowledge and skills.
